Transaction 01331186e156d3a8f3a4e159b995975df9f2492294e0423d37e8cb6f623c8c4f
1 Input
2 Outputs
- 01331186e156d3a8f3a4e159b995975df9f2492294e0423d37e8cb6f623c8c4f:0
- 01331186e156d3a8f3a4e159b995975df9f2492294e0423d37e8cb6f623c8c4f:1
value 87429322
address 1BGVzjZt1gLv1bHvdmnUgtjetgTazpXYBj
value 630590
address 17FCcmBBYot72dRYn5ap6YLzboxMz4WkPa